What are the different types of secondary markets for cryptocurrencies?
Can you explain the various secondary markets available for trading cryptocurrencies? How do they differ from primary markets? What are the advantages and disadvantages of each type of secondary market?
5 answers
- Joel Lopez MSep 20, 2025 · 8 months agoIn the world of cryptocurrencies, secondary markets refer to platforms where users can buy and sell digital assets after they have been initially issued in a primary market, such as an initial coin offering (ICO) or token sale. These secondary markets provide liquidity and enable investors to trade their cryptocurrencies. Some popular types of secondary markets include cryptocurrency exchanges, decentralized exchanges (DEXs), and over-the-counter (OTC) markets. Each type has its own unique features and benefits.
- Livingston BellJan 27, 2021 · 5 years agoCryptocurrency exchanges are centralized platforms where users can trade a wide range of cryptocurrencies. They offer a user-friendly interface, high liquidity, and a variety of trading pairs. However, they are susceptible to hacking and regulatory risks. On the other hand, decentralized exchanges operate on blockchain technology and allow users to trade directly with each other without the need for intermediaries. They provide more privacy and security, but may have lower liquidity and limited trading options. OTC markets, on the other hand, facilitate large-volume trades directly between buyers and sellers, often without the need for order books. They offer personalized service and better price negotiation, but may have higher fees and less transparency.
